minitestFileInfo.xmlName = QetestUtils.filenameToURL(inputDir + File.separator + "Minitest.xml"); minitestFileInfo.goldName = goldDir + File.separator + "Minitest.out"; return true; } /** * Basic functional test of serialized Templates objects. * Reproduce Bugzilla 2005 by [EMAIL PROTECTED] * http://nagoya.apache.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=2005 * * @return false if we should abort the test; true otherwise */ public boolean testCase1() { reporter.testCaseInit("Basic functional test of serialized Templates objects"); try { TransformerFactory factory = TransformerFactory.newInstance(); // Create templates from normal stylesheet Templates origTemplates = factory.newTemplates(new StreamSource(testFileInfo.inputName)); // Serialize the Templates to disk reporter.logInfoMsg("About to serialize " + testFileInfo.inputName + " templates to: " + outNames.nextName()); FileOutputStream ostream = new FileOutputStream(outNames.currentName()); ObjectOutputStream oos = new java.io.ObjectOutputStream(ostream); oos.writeObject(origTemplates); oos.flush(); ostream.close(); // Read the Templates back in reporter.logInfoMsg("About to read templates back"); FileInputStream istream = new FileInputStream(outNames.currentName()); ObjectInputStream ois = new ObjectInputStream(istream); Templates templates = (Templates)ois.readObject(); istream.close(); // Use the Templates in a transform reporter.logInfoMsg("About to call newTransformer"); Transformer transformer = templates.newTransformer(); reporter.logInfoMsg("About to transform(xmlDoc, StreamResult(" + outNames.nextName() + "))"); transformer.transform(new StreamSource(testFileInfo.xmlName), new StreamResult(outNames.currentName())); fileChecker.check(reporter, new File(outNames.currentName()), new File(testFileInfo.goldName), "Using serialized Templates, transform into " + outNames.currentName()); } catch (Throwable t) { reporter.checkFail("Problem with serialized Template");
